Meaning of 'detail' (Webster Dictionary)

1 . Detail [ n.]
- A minute portion; one of the small parts; a particular; an item; -- used chiefly in the plural; as, the details of a scheme or transaction.
- A narrative which relates minute points; an account which dwells on particulars.
- The selection for a particular service of a person or a body of men; hence, the person or the body of men so selected.
- To relate in particulars; to particularize; to report minutely and distinctly; to enumerate; to specify; as, he detailed all the facts in due order.
- To tell off or appoint for a particular service, as an officer, a troop, or a squadron.

Meaning of 'detail' (Princeton's WordNet)

1 . detail [ n]
Meaning (1):
- a crew of workers selected for a particular task
Example in sentence:
  • a detail was sent to remove the fallen trees
Meaning (2):
- an isolated fact that is considered separately from the whole
Example in sentence:
  • a point of information;
  • several of the details are similar
Meaning (3):
- a small part that can be considered separately from the whole
Example in sentence:
  • it was perfect in all details
Meaning (4):
- extended treatment of particulars
Example in sentence:
  • the essay contained too much detail
Meaning (5):
- a temporary military unit
Example in sentence:
  • the peacekeeping force includes one British contingent
6 . detail [ v]
Meaning (6):
- assign to a specific task
Example in sentence:
  • The ambulances were detailed to the fire station
